I'm not a native speeker and maybe I misunderstood one of Your sentences so please could You be so kind and verify my summary: Updating scripts The latest Papyrus Scripts are backwards compatible with 1.46. To update an existing save game only with new scripts, first deactivate DynDOLOD, wait for deactivation message, go into interior, check MCM DynDOLOD is still deactivated, save, exit game. Replace scripts, start game, load the save, go outside, activate DynDOLOD. If you do not intent to generate LOD, do not replace/overwrite anything else like meshes or textures from 1.46 to not disturb an existing save game. I guess better running scripts are better for my game even if I don't want to update the .esp or generate new meshes. The scripts will work with 1.46 so this should be done. ----- Updating LOD If you intend to update LOD of an existing save game by updating the existing DynDOLOD.esp, overwrite the 1.46 meshes but do not delete any of the old meshes/textures so either a file is the old or new version but not one of the old files goes missing. So it means in MO I chose the merging option when installing, so nothing gets deleted and my Output files are still compatible. What's the point in updating just the .esp and not generating new meshes? ----- Generate LOD from scratch If you intend to generate LOD from scratch, replace - not overwrite - the meshes/textures from 1.46. Delete meshes/textures from 1.46 first, then install the meshes/textures from the archive. I would prefer to do this if I have to update because it would not mix old meshes with new .esp and scripts.
